(a) Generally. When a gasoline or diesel engine is found to be visibly emitting air contaminants in violation of this article, a summons shall be served on the owner or operator thereof, requiring an appearance in municipal court.

(b) Repair and testing. If, prior to the court appearance date, the vehicle which is the subject of the summons issued pursuant to either section 134-324 or 134-325 is repaired and found to be in compliance with all local visible vehicle air pollution standards after a test approved by the City, the summons shall be dismissed without further proceedings. Such compliance shall be evidenced by an appropriate written document. (Code 1979, § 37-118)
